Selangor Tengku Permaisuri launches Padat books on Malay culture, customs

By Mustakim Ramli

SHAH ALAM, Aug 8 — The Tengku Permaisuri of Selangor Tengku Permaisuri Norashikin officiated the launch of seven books published by the Selangor Malay Customs and Heritage Corporation (Padat) earlier today.

The books include Kesenian Telepuk Warisan Melayu Selangor, Penyelidikan Terkini Nisan Aceh di Selangor, and Warisan Telepuk Alam Melayu, all written by Intan Salina Idrus.

Other book titles are Kebaya Selangor (by Rohayu Mohd Yunus), Permainan Wau Kapal (by Abdullah Anas Abu Bakar), Sulaman Kelingkan Melayu (by Mohd Subli Musa) and Tarian Piring Selangor (by Mohd Lotfi Nazar).

The ceremony was officiated by Her Royal Highness at the Raja Tun Uda Library here.

The publication of the books is part of Padat's efforts to preserve and document Selangor’s heritage, tradition and culture as sources of reference for the community and younger generations.
